Dรฉtails du cours
โข Introduction to Nanorods in Aerospace Materials: Overview of nanorods, their unique properties, and potential applications in aerospace materials.
โข Synthesis Techniques for Nanorod Production: Examination of various methods for producing nanorods, including chemical, physical, and biological techniques.
โข Properties of Nanorods for Aerospace Applications: Analysis of the mechanical, thermal, electrical, and optical properties of nanorods and their relevance to aerospace materials.
โข Nanorod-Reinforced Composites: Study of the fabrication, characterization, and testing of nanorod-reinforced composite materials for aerospace applications.
โข Nanorods for Thermal Management in Aerospace: Investigation of the use of nanorods for thermal management in aerospace materials, including heat dissipation and thermal barrier coatings.
โข Nanorods for Electromagnetic Interference Shielding: Examination of the potential of nanorods for electromagnetic interference shielding in aerospace materials.
โข Nanorods for Sensing and Actuation: Analysis of the use of nanorods for sensing and actuation in aerospace applications, including strain sensors and chemical sensors.
โข Challenges and Opportunities in Nanorod Research: Discussion of the current challenges and opportunities in nanorod research, including scalability, cost-effectiveness, and environmental impact.
โข Future Directions in Nanorods for Aerospace: Exploration of the potential future directions for nanorod research in aerospace materials, including new applications and emerging technologies.
